The voice of the Mavs Mark Followill and former Mavs director of basketball development Brian Dameris bring you all of the insight, analysis, funny stories and interviews with players, execs, and your favorite Mavs commentators every week on THE essential Dallas Mavericks podcast for the true MFFL!

What is Take Dat Wit You about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Listeners can expect a dynamic exploration of the Dallas Mavericks, featuring a mix of insights and analysis from knowledgeable hosts. Topics range from basketball strategy and player performances to personal anecdotes and historical reflections on the Mavs and the NBA as a whole. Episodes often highlight unique guest interviews, offering perspectives from players, executives, and sports commentators, which contribute to a comprehensive understanding of the team's current state as well as its future prospects. The engaging style likely appeals to both die-hard fans and casual listeners wanting to deepen their connection with the Mavericks.
